duckbill

5 senses ·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. n. See Duck mole, under Duck, n. Source: opted
  2. 2. adj. having a beak resembling that of a duck Source: wordnet
  3. 3. n. primitive fish of the Mississippi valley having a long paddle-shaped snout Source: wordnet
  4. 4. n. small densely furred aquatic monotreme of Australia and Tasmania having a broad bill and tail and webbed feet; only species in the family Ornithorhynchidae Source: wordnet
